Framework
The Seng Kang Primary School English Language Framework is anchored in the school’s vision, “Thinkers Today, Leaders Tomorrow,” which shapes the desired outcomes of our learners. Guided by the English Language department’s vision of developing confident and competent communicators in internationally acceptable English, the framework provides a coherent and purposeful approach to language teaching and learning.
At its core, the framework emphasises a strong foundation and joy of learning through the MOE STELLAR 2.0 curriculum. Students develop the four key language skills - listening, speaking, reading, and writing - alongside grammar and vocabulary, applied in meaningful and authentic contexts.
Encircling this core are key pedagogical approaches, including explicit instruction, inquiry through dialogue, contextualised learning, metacognition, spiral progression, and assessment for learning, which guide teaching and support deep, sustained learning.
Extending outwards, the framework is enriched by the school’s signature programmes and experiences that promote oracy, reading culture, creative expression, and student agency, providing platforms for students to apply language with purpose and confidence.
Together, these elements work cohesively to realise the school’s vision, nurturing SKLites to become thoughtful users of language today and effective leaders of tomorrow.
